Abstract
"PROCESSOS DE PREPARAçãO DE MICRORGANISMOS EVOLUìDOS E DE UMA PROTEìNA EVOLUìDA E DE BIOTRANSFORMAçãO, GENE EVOLUìDO, PROTEìNA EVOLUìDA, E UTILIZAçãO DE UM MICRORGANISMO EVOLUìDO OU DE UMA PROTEìNA EVOLUìDA". A presente invenção trata de um novo processo de preparação de microrganismo evoluídos permitindo uma modificação das vias metabólicas, caracterizado pelo fato que compreende as etapas seguintes: a) obtenção de um microrganismo modificado por modificação genética das células de um microrganismo inicial de maneira a inibir a produção ou o consumo de um metabólito quando o microrganismo é cultivado sobre um meio definido, afetando desta forma a capacidade de crescimento do microrganismo; b) cultura dos microrganismos modificados obtidos anteriormente sobre o dito meio definido para fazê-lo evoluir; pode ser necessário acrescentar um co-substrato ao meio definido a fim de permitir esta evolução; c) seleção das células de microrganismos modificados capazes de se desenvolver sobre o meio definido, eventualmente com um co-substrato. A invenção trata igualmente das cepas de microrganismos evoluidos assim obtidas, os genes evoluídos codificadores para proteinas evoluídas suscetíveis de ser obtidos pelo processo de acordo com a invenção e a utilização dos ditos microrganismos, genes ou proteinas evoluidos em um processo de biotransformação.
